What does the splitting of the Pacific Islands Forum mean for Australia?

What does the splitting of the Pacific Islands Forum mean for Australia? Posted WedWednesday 10 updated WedWednesday 10 FebFebruary 2021 at 2:37pm Five island nations say they will begin the process of withdrawing from the Pacific Islands Forum. ( Share Print text only Early on Tuesday morning, the Pacific Islands Forum split. It s a heavy blow for the regional body which sits at the apex of the region s diplomatic architecture. But what does it mean for Australia? Is there a way the Pacific Islands Forum (PIF) can be patched back together? And what will happen if those efforts fail? What caused the split? According to the Micronesian leaders, it s all about respect.

Samoa to make another move today to shift USP headquarters to Apia Samoa to make another move today to shift USP headquarters to Apia Friday 05/02/2021 Samoa has confirmed it will pursue moving the University of the South Pacific headquarters from Fiji to Samoa. Radio NZ is reporting that the revelation follows the Fijian government s deportation of USP Vice Chancellor and President, Professor Pal Ahluwalia and his wife after they were whisked away from their home in the middle of the night by immigration officers. Samoa s Minister of Education, Loau Keneti Sio has revealed that moving the university headquarters to Samoa will be on the agenda of today s USP Council meeting.
